By a News Reporter-Staff News Editor at Robotics & Machine Learning Daily News Daily News – Data detailed on Robotics - Robotics a nd Automation have been presented. According to news reporting out of Trondheim, Norway, by NewsRx editors, research stated, “Motion planning for autonomous act ive perception in cluttered environments remains a challenging problem, requirin g real-time solutions that both maximize safety and achieve a desired behavior. In dynamic underwater environments, such as in aquaculture operations, the robot s are additionally expected to deal with state and motion uncertainty and errors , dynamic and deformable obstacles, currents, and disturbances.”
